10 Usage Examples Depicting the Meaning of 'Bedaub' in a Sentence
"To smear or spread something, typically a substance, all over a surface, resulting in a soiled or besmeared appearance." more

The children decided to bedaub their hands with colorful paints during the art class.
The artist carefully bedaubs the canvas with vibrant colors to create a mesmerizing painting.
She had bedaubed her hands with paint while working on her art project.
Sarah decided to bedaub her drawing with glitter to make it sparkle and shine.
By the time the artist finishes the mural, he will have been bedaubing the canvas for weeks.
The artist used a brush to bedaub the canvas with broad strokes, creating a dynamic composition.
The artist's abstract painting was created by allowing various colors to bedaub the canvas freely.
During the finger painting activity, Sarah chose to bedaub her paper with vibrant hues.
The artist used a palette knife to bedaub the canvas with textured layers of paint.
The sculptor chose to bedaub the statue with a bronze patina, giving it an aged appearance.
